** Shares of IGO IGO.AX fall 5% to A$4.410, their lowest level since November 2020
** Battery metal producer reports HY loss after tax attributable A$782.1 million ($495.69 million), compared with a profit of A$288.3 million last year
** Reduction in profit was primarily due to the Group's lower profits from the Tianqi Lithium Energy Australia joint venture, which decreased to a share of loss of A$602.2 million for the period - co
** Stock down 5.9% YTD, including current session's moves
